This is less a near-term trading event than a micro-cap financing and execution setup wrapped in a sustainability narrative. At a ~$28M market cap, the equity is trading on optionality rather than fundamentals, so the real catalyst path is not top-line headlines but whether the company can prove product-market fit with repeatable gross margins before dilution overwhelms any operating leverage. In that regime, the stock tends to behave like a binary capital-structure instrument: a small operational win can re-rate it sharply, but a single weak financing round can erase months of upside.
The second-order winner, if the story gains traction, is not necessarily the issuer but adjacent agricultural input channels that benefit from a policy-supported shift toward regenerative/low-carbon fertilizer solutions. The competitive threat is to incumbents that rely on commodity nutrient pricing and merchant distribution, because even modest adoption by growers can pressure them to bundle pricing, extend credit, or accelerate their own “green” product lines. That said, the moat risk is high: if the product does not show clear agronomic ROI, the ESG angle alone will not sustain volume, especially in a weak commodity farm economy where farmers are highly price-elastic.
The main risk window is months, not days. In the next 1-2 quarters, the stock is vulnerable to dilution, low-liquidity volatility, and any sign that commercialization is slower than promotional momentum implies. The contrarian view is that the market may be underestimating how quickly small-cap climate names can move on non-financial catalysts, but also overestimating the durability of that move absent a credible path to self-funding growth.
